&lt;blockquote&gt;The poll, conducted this past weekend by the Washington, D.C. firm Momentum Analysis, shows that, if the election were held today, 44% of respondents would vote for Wulsin, 44% would vote for Schmidt, and 11% were undecided.  Wulsin leads 50% to 37% in Hamilton County, the largest county in the district. &lt;/p&gt;
